A Postgraduate Certificate in Edge Computing Security for Robotics equips professionals with the advanced knowledge and practical skills necessary to secure robotic systems operating in diverse environments. This specialized program focuses on the unique challenges presented by edge computing architectures, where data processing occurs closer to the source, and the increasing reliance on robotics across multiple sectors.
Learning outcomes include a deep understanding of security threats specific to edge computing in robotics, such as data breaches, denial-of-service attacks, and malware. Students develop expertise in implementing robust security measures, including authentication, authorization, and encryption protocols. They'll also gain hands-on experience with security tools and technologies relevant to robotic systems and the Internet of Things (IoT).
The program's duration is typically designed to be flexible, catering to working professionals. A common structure involves part-time study over a period of 6 to 12 months, though variations may exist depending on the institution. This flexible structure allows for continued professional engagement alongside academic pursuits.

A Postgraduate Certificate in Edge Computing Security for Robotics is increasingly significant in today's UK market. The rapid growth of robotics across various sectors, from manufacturing (UK Robotics and Autonomous Systems report indicates a 15% YoY growth in the sector) to healthcare, necessitates robust security measures. Edge computing, processing data closer to the source, is crucial for real-time robotic applications, but this proximity introduces new security vulnerabilities. This postgraduate certificate addresses this critical need, equipping professionals with the skills to mitigate risks associated with data breaches, malware attacks, and unauthorized access in robotic systems.
